we function
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"we function"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e how a group or organization operates or behaves in a particular context. Example: "In this project, we function as a cohesive unit, ensuring that all tasks are completed efficiently."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When discussing efficiency or improvements, follow "we function" with an adverb or adjective to highlight the quality of operation. For example, "we function efficiently" or "we function as a team."
Common error
Avoid using "we function" in contexts where individual actions are more relevant than collective processes. Focus on individual contributions when highlighting personal skills or achievements rather than team-based operations.

More alternative expressions(10)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
how we operate
Focuses on the method or process of operation, similar to how something functions.
how we perform
Emphasizes the level or quality of execution.
the way we work
Highlights the manner or style of working, indicating a procedural approach.
our mode of operation
Uses more formal language to describe the typical method or style of functioning.
our functional capacity
Specifically addresses the ability to perform required functions, often in a professional context.
how we conduct ourselves
Refers to behavior and demeanor, suggesting a focus on conduct within the functioning process.
our working dynamic
Emphasizes the interaction and relationships within a working environment, influencing how the function is carried out.
the mechanics of our process
Directs attention to the detailed steps and procedures that make up how something functions.
our behavioral pattern
Highlights consistent actions or responses as part of the overall functioning style.
our system of working
Refers to a structured set of procedures or methods that define how tasks are managed and completed.
FAQs
How can I use "we function" in a sentence?
You can use "we function" to describe how a group or organization operates. For example, "In this project, "we function" as a cohesive unit, ensuring all tasks are completed efficiently."
What phrases are similar to "we function"?
Similar phrases include "how we operate", "the way we work", or "our mode of operation". The best choice depends on the specific context.
When is it appropriate to use "we function" in formal writing?
"We function" is suitable for formal writing when discussing team dynamics, organizational processes, or systemic operations. Ensure the context is professional and the statement adds clarity to the operational description.
What's the difference between "we function" and "we operate"?
While both phrases describe operational processes, "we function" often implies a focus on the roles and interactions within a system, whereas "we operate" might emphasize the overall execution and mechanics of a process.
